While we have our favorite summertime regions such as Muscadet, Mosel or Galicia, we thought it would be fun to go outside of the box (or in this case sipper pack) and present some often overlooked thirst quenching regions and varietals to get you through the beginning of the dog days of summer. Our selections are the perfect accompaniment to your next backyard barbecue, beach day, or just good old fashioned "me time" spent on your front porch.

Our 6 pack includes:

NV Domaine du Mouton Noir Vouvray Brut - Loire Valley, France
Impressions: We love a good Crémant and our go-to region for champagne-like bubbly is the Loire. Lovely notes of stone fruits, white flowers and brioche evolve from the glass. The fresh acidity carries forth an elegant mousse that glides towards a dry, refreshing and fruity finish.

2022 Leon Boesch Edelzwicker [1000ML] - Alsace, France
Impressions: 'Edelzwicker' are the traditional white wine blends of Alsace that serve as an introduction to the region's wines. This one displays a lovely floral, spicy and fruity bouquet upon opening. The palate is tense, with a nice interplay between its fresh acidity and it mineral-dense texture. The finish is dry, fruity and savory making this an incredibly diverse food pairing wine. Even better, this is a Liter!

2022 Simoneau Oiso Touraine Sauvignon Blanc - Loire Valley, France
Impressions: Sauvignon Blanc from the Touraine are normally not as interesting as this latest vintage from Oiso. Notes of passionfruit, grapefruit pith, lemongrass and wet stones compete for your attention. The palate is lean and mineral-driven with a crisp, herbal finish. This is the perfect wine to pair with grilled vegetables, and salads.

2023 Schloss Goebelsburg 'Cistercien' Rosé - Burgenland, Austria
Impressions: Hands down the most refreshing rosé we've tried this year, it opens with aromas of strawberries, watermelon skin, snap peas and a hint of dried herbs. The palate is fresh with a crisp minerality that leans into a dry, fruity finish with a touch of salinity. Goes down dangerously easy.

2021 Domaine Le Roc 'Folle Noire d'Ambat' Fronton - Southwest, France
Impressions: For those that like full-bodied red wine aromas without the heavy structure, this Negrette based wine is for you. Notes of blackberries, iron, black peppercorns, teriyaki and balsamic leap from the glass. The palate is light and silky with an earthy tannic touch that leads towards a dry, peppery and slightly smoky finish. An excellent wine to pair with grilled meats and sausages.

2013 La Antigua Clasico Crianza - Rioja, Spain
Impressions: This is perhaps the best quality to price ratio bottle we've ever carried. Notes of cassis, figs, blackberry compote, iron, maitakes and cinder greet from the glass. The palate is lush and silky with a light to medium bodied frame that sways towards a light velvety tannic touch. The finish is spicy, earthy and slightly smoky making this an ideal pairing for lamb, brisket or ribs.
